그림파일을 분류하여서 데이터베이스화하는법

그린   
   조회 1589   추천 0    

그림파일또는 그림이 들어간 매뉴얼을 분루하여서 검색하기쉽게 데이타베이스화하려고합니다

회사에서는 이런 매뉴얼을 어떻게 데이타베이스화하나요

혹시 이미 만들어진 포탈사이트의 앱이나 블로그등을 이용하는방법도 있나요...

액세스를  db로하는 asp데이타베이스앱이 이미 만들어져서 공개된것도 있나요

 

액세스의 필드에 그림을 저장하려면 하드디스크의 폴더에 그림파일들을 저장하고 그것에 대한 포인터를 액세스 필드에 넣어야하나요.

필드에 그림자체를 넣을수없나요.

SQL server는 필드자체에 그림을 넣을수있나요.이것도 포인터만 넣는것외에는 다른방법이없나요

그림파일의 포인터는 무엇으로 그림파일을 인식하게하나요.그림파일에 고유번호를 붙여야하나요


만약에 그림을 저장한폴더의 위치가변경되면 액세스의 모든필드에서 포인터를 변경하여야하는데 이런문제는 어떻게 해결하나요.

감사합니다 

짧은글 일수록 신중하게.
epowergate 2022-06
원하시는 스펙 명확하게 정리하시고 원하시는 화면 그리셔서 크몽 같은곳에 올리면 50만원 / 2~3일 이면 만들어 올 겁니다
blob등 사용하면 그리 어렵지 않을 겁니다.
Qsup 2022-06
1. 해당 이미지의 해쉬값 체크
2. DB에 해쉬값 저장
3. DB의 해쉬값을 체크해서 특정 위치 내에 해당 이미지 파일이 있는지 여부 확인 후 불러오는 기능의 프로그램 개발
곽순현 2022-06
Blob
정의석 2022-06
MS SQLServer는 컬럼타입에 image가 있는데, 이것은 이미지데이터를 BLOB(일것으로 추정)형태로 바로 넣을 수 있습니다.
그리고 찾아보니 Access에서도 BLOB가 가능하네요.
https://www.codeproject.com/Articles/16851/Uploading-and-Downloading-BLOBs-to-Microsoft-Acces

DB에 실제 파일의 위치만 넣어두면, 실제 파일을 관리해야 하는 번거러움이 있습니다. 상대경로든 절대경로든 이 경로를 계속 유지 해야 한다는 압박이 있습니다.
이 경우 전체적인 폴더 구조만 변하지 않았다면, DB데이터를 Update 해서 변경된 경로에 대응할 수는 있지만, 어쨌거나 이런일이 벌어지면 귀찮습니다.
만일, BLOB형태로 데이타를 넣으면 이런 문제는 없지만, DB가 너무 커지는 문제는 있습니다.

몇몇 상용 DB 관리도구들은 별도의 코딩 없어 이 BLOB데이터를 실제 파일(그림파일 등)로 다시 Export할 수도 있습니다.
윈도우에서는 파워쉘로도 가능하고요..
https://blog.naver.com/usjung97/222500438675
https://blog.naver.com/usjung97/222423336987
그린 2022-06
감사합니다 믾은도움이되었습니다


QnA
제목Page 4988/5715
2015-12   1731355   백메가
2014-05   5198675   정은준1
2015-02   3342   전설속의미…
2013-10   35312   배고프고가…
2011-03   7525   홍상훈
2017-04   4405   stone92김경민
2011-03   6471   차평석
2018-07   4310   캔위드
2022-05   3343   2CPUI김세훈
2024-01   1840   ryankor
2015-03   4776   깨모
2015-03   4238   코끼리곧휴
2011-04   6483   김건우
2019-09   3664   이건희
2018-07   3850   무명인12
2018-07   4177   Nikon
2013-11   11135   김정현B
2019-09   15230   wjdqh6544
2020-12   3984   블루영상
2011-04   8367   가빠로구나
2022-06   1590   그린
2018-07   3757   전산직딩